Take advantage of Eurail’s pass special before the end of June

June 24th, 2009 by The Backpackers Team

picture-23.pngBackpackers exploring Europe this summer and hoping to save a few bucks on travel costs, listen up.  The ever-vigilant Kathleen who writes About.com’s student travel blog explains the special better than we could:

“Love this Eurail sale on now: buy a qualifying Eurail pass by June 30, 2009 and Rail Europe will give you a credit voucher good for 25 percent of the value of that pass, which can be used toward up to 75 percent of any rail travel purchase made by December 20, 2009, provided your second purchase is at least 1.34 times the value of credit. Okay, this is how it works:

For example, buy a $586 Eurail Youth Global pass (that’s the already discounted student price) and get a voucher for $146.50 (25 percent). Subsequently save $146.50 when you buy any Rail Europe passes or tickets worth at least $196.31 (1.34 times the dollar value of your credit ) next fall. That could be up to 75% off a different pass or a point-to-point ticket which you discover you need to buy on top of your pass. “  (more of that here)

Whilst you’re at it, you can also score an extra two days of free train travel if you book a Eurail 8-day Select Pass through Rail Europe from June 1 to July 31, 2009 (you’ll need to have an ISIC card).  More about that here.

White Mountain earlybird tickets on sale now

June 2nd, 2009 by The Backpackers Team

If you want to get away from it all and chill out in a superb mountain setting while listening to acoustic performances by some of South Africa’s top artists, then look no further than the annual White Mountain Folk Festival.

Running from 24 to 27 September 2009, this laid-back music festival is held at White Mountain Lodge near Giant’s Castle in the beautiful Central Drakensberg region of KwaZulu-Natal, just 34km from Estcourt on tarred roads, 200km from Durban and 430km from Johannesburg.

wmff_banner_09_400.gifOn offer is a four-day programme of chilled acoustic music, as well as a wide choice of outdoor leisure activities, arts and crafts, a beer market and assorted food stalls.  Festival-goers can also make full use of the lodge’s facilities, including a restaurant, pub, games room, swimming pool and satellite TV.

Early Bird tickets are now on sale at Computicket for just ZAR350, which is a saving of ZAR150 on the gate price.  This offer is limited to 500 tickets only, so make sure you get in early.  The price includes camping in the newly graded and grassed festival campsite overlooking the dam.

Now in its fourth year, White Mountain has quickly become a firm favourite on the events calendar and is not to be missed.  The line-up is currently being finalised and will be announced shortly.  For more information, visit www.whitemountain.co.za or contact Pedro at +27 82 892 6176.
